An Early Christian Reaction to Islam : : Išū'yahb III and the Muslim Arabs / / Iskandar Bcheiry.

The year 652 marked a fundamental political change in the Middle East and the surrounding region. On this date the Sasanid Empire collapsed and the major part of the Byzantine dominion in the East was lost to the hands of Muslim Arabs.
